Output 58ab726bffcb23bdbad9436477a01cb5b6b4b16d71432989bb268db9d94cde98:0

value
655866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e5fa87e981790db03762a7b56a59b3f961cd23 OP_EQUAL
address
3AtWzvTpq4BEaccK79CQthoeoX7fWk6zNH
transaction
58ab726bffcb23bdbad9436477a01cb5b6b4b16d71432989bb268db9d94cde98
spent
false

2 Sat Ranges